Piyush Mishra gives lesson in nationalism

LUCKNOW: Noted lyricist and scriptwriter Piyush Mishra exhorted the budding managers to be

true nationalists

. “Jo apne desh ka nahi hua woh apni girlfriend ka kya hoga (One who is not committed to the nation, cannot be so to his girlfriend),” said Mishra while interacting with the young audience on the first day of the three-day annual business, cultural and sports fest, Manfest-Varchasva.

Speaking about the country’s current political scenario on the sidelines of the event, Mishra said, “There is no option other than PM Narendra Modi who can run this nation better.” Mishra added that leaders like Nitish Kumar and Akhilesh Yadav are dynamic who can take the country forward but at present, it’s only Modi.

Elaborating on nationalism, he said, “We must learn nationalism from Western countries. When the national anthem is played there, even football players stand in the ground. But in India, nationalism and patriotism are linked with anything and everything,” he added.
